Chapter 71: Chapter 71: How Did You Do on the Exam?

"Pa!"

The slap echoed loudly, and Mrs. Zhang’s face immediately swelled up, with five clear finger marks visible.

In the room were Li Xiangxiang and Li Qingxue, the two little girls whispering in a corner, with Bai Chuan nearby. The room was bustling with chatter until that sound brought silence.

Zhang Meihua covered her face, the sting burning hotly. She was the rowdy and aggressive type, and now that her mother-in-law had hit her, was she going to take it? 𝑓𝓇𝘦ℯ𝘸𝘦𝑏𝓃𝑜𝘷ℯ𝑙.𝑐𝑜𝓂

She covered half her face, pointing at Li Qingmu and started cursing: "Mother, he was an unwanted bastard from the start, not even a member of the Li family, and you hit me for an outsider? How could your heart be so biased?"

"Zhang Meihua, you little wench, you dare speak!"

Mrs. Li Zhou widened her eyes in anger, ready to slap Zhang Meihua again, but her son Li Qinghai stopped her.

"Mother, mother, calm down, don’t hit, don’t hit! If you break something, you’ll have to pay!"

At the mention of having to pay, Mrs. Li Zhou hesitated and ultimately held back from hitting her again.

"Mother, is what Second Sister-in-law said true?"

Li Qingmu’s cold voice cut through, sending a chill down everyone’s spine.

His gaze swept over each person, finally landing on Mrs. Li Zhou.

He was already lean, and since the traumatic event of being chased and falling off a cliff, he had become even thinner, with a face as sharp as a knife, adding an intimidating edge to his look.

Mrs. Li Zhou kept a stern face, initially thinking this matter could be suppressed, but seeing the third son’s demeanor, it was clear it couldn’t be contained.

This kid had always been smart, able to concoct a whole scenario with even the slightest hint. Now that Mrs. Zhang had spoken so clearly, how could he not know?

Just look at that cold, indifferent gaze, did he used to look at me like this?

Mrs. Li Zhou felt uneasy. She had raised Li Qingmu because she believed this boy was of remarkable origin and might bring glory to the family. Everything was going as she predicted; he excelled in school, and even the teacher often praised him, saying he could have a bright future and become a high-ranking official!

Becoming an official could bring them prosperity, no longer needing to cater to the neighbors, possibly even standing above others, and avenging the humiliation they had suffered!

On the brink of realizing her dream, this incident happened!

Mrs. Li Zhou was frustrated but didn’t want to lose the good fortune that was at hand. She wanted to confirm if Li Qingmu had indeed passed the Scholar exam, but with Zhang’s interruption, how could she?

People asked, "Am I your son?"

Your response, "Did you pass?"

It’s completely irrelevant!

Fortunately, A qiu, the little rascal, salvaged the situation. He couldn’t believe his third brother wasn’t his real brother and was a bit stunned. Hurriedly, he ran over, clutching Mrs. Li Zhou’s hem: "Mother, what Second Sister-in-law said isn’t true, right? How could Third Brother not be my real brother? It can’t be, Third Brother is so good to me... It can’t be, Second Sister-in-law is lying!"

"Who’s lying to you? The other day I passed by father and mother’s room, overheard by their window! Mother was murmuring to father about how the third wasn’t their biological son and whether he’d turn his back on them once successful. Father said to treat him well, and if he dared not acknowledge them in the future, to make a fuss and shame him..."

"Zhang Meihua!"

Mrs. Li Zhou was ready to burst. What kind of person would say such things? You’re leaving no room for survival!

Earlier, She thought this daughter-in-law was insightful, understanding her intentions, but now feels she’s a real troublemaker!

Mrs. Li Zhou completely lost it, even Li Qinghai couldn’t hold her back, rushing in to brawl with Zhang Meihua. But Mrs. Zhang was stronger and quickly gained the upper hand, so Mrs. Wang smartly helped Mrs. Li Zhou, followed by the two sons trying to separate them...

For a moment, the Li family was in chaos.

Ignoring the surrounding commotion, Li Qingmu slowly closed his eyes, the events of the past few years flashing rapidly through his mind.

Indeed, dragons give birth to dragons, phoenixes to phoenixes, and the offspring of mice know how to dig holes. He truly didn’t seem like the child of this family.

Before, he was suspicious, but people are often confused by their circumstances, unwilling to think too deeply. Li Qingmu had entertained the thought several times but ultimately pushed it aside. Now was the time to face it.

Long Yue’s attention was mostly on him, and seeing him like this, worried about his emotional instability, she hurriedly grabbed his hand.

"Husband..."

"I’m fine."

He said softly, then slowly opened his eyes, which were now clear, devoid of any confusion. What a remarkably strong mentality!

Many people, upon receiving life-altering news, would be momentarily stunned and at a loss. But her husband seemed as if nothing had happened, his nature only earning Long Yue’s deep admiration!

In the eyes of a lover, even flaws become perfect, and now Long Yue found her husband more pleasing than ever.

"Hey, have you Li Family members yelled enough? My Nannan has been woken by you and won’t stop crying. It’s ridiculous, what kind of bad luck has befallen us to have neighbors like you, tch!"

From the front gate came Aunt Zhang’s scolding voice. She had four sons and only last year had a daughter, who was dearly cherished by the family. It was noon, and they had eaten and were ready for a nap when they realized the disturbance from the Li family across the street. It irritated her, and she ran over to complain.

Her loud voice, mixed with the northern wind, was heard by everyone from the Li family, momentarily halting the noisy atmosphere.

Li Qingyuan and Li Qinghai quickly took advantage of this moment to pull apart their mother, Mrs. Wang, and Mrs. Zhang, though all three were left with scratches, and their clothes were torn, with Mrs. Li Zhou having a new scratch on her face.

As the room calmed down, Mrs. Li Zhou was still panting heavily, while Li Qingmu gave them a cold glance, adjusted his cloak, and said blandly, "Mother, there’s no need to argue any more, everything, just follow your arrangement!"

The implication was, if you want us to leave, we’ll leave; if not, we’ll stay!

After Li Qingmu finished speaking, he looked at them, waiting for Mrs. Li Zhou to make a final decision.

Mrs. Li Zhou rubbed her sore arm, glanced at the expressionless third son, and holding onto her last bit of hope, asked, "You...how did you do on the exam?"

With those words, everyone’s attention turned to Li Qingmu.
